It's all cardio but kickboxing works the abs within the workout.
Intensity wise, it is like Cathe's workouts, but the 3 Powerstrikes I have (M-1, M-2, M-3) are all low impact, no jumping or plyo moves, but the speed of the workout keeps the intensity high.
The warm ups are about maybe 10min, and the cooldowns about 5min or so. The total workout from start to finish is 60min on all 3 videos.

Nothing I've found equals Cathe's intensity, but I do have to give Powerstrikes a "thumbs up" for coming in close.

Now, not everyone likes the newest Powerstrike M-3, but I do! It is a bit more organized than the previous M-1 and M-2 workouts, and works the body more evenly than the other 2 workouts. The previous ones first worked one side of your body, then moved to the other, but M-3 works them evenly switching from side to side with each new combo.
But they are intense kickboxing workouts, and I like them 2nd to Cathe's CK and CTX kickbox.
